Appropriate Preposition:

  • Offend against ( লঙ্গন করা ) You have offended against good manners.
  • Commence on ( শুরু করা ) Our examination commences on the 3rd July.
  • Disgusted at ( বিরক্ত ) I am disgusted with him at his conduct.
  • Vain of ( অহঙ্কারী ) She is vain of her beauty.
  • Appeal to ( আবেদন করা (ব্যক্তি) ) He appealed to the Headmaster for pardon.
  • Count for ( গণ্য হওয়া ) His advice counts for nothing.

Idioms:

  • Book worm ( গ্রন্থকীট ) Don't be a book worm.
  • Bird of a feather ( এক রকম স্বভাবের লোক ) Birds of a feather flock together.
  • At bay ( কোনঠাসা ) The tiger was at bay in the bush.
  • At dagger drawn ( খড়গহস্ত ) The two brothers are now at daggers drawn.
  • queer go ( অদ্ভুত ব্যপার )
  • Call in question ( সন্দেহ করা ) No one can call his honesty in question.
